ERCOL

/live/blogs/ercol 1.jpg

In a state-of-the-art factory on the outskirts of Princes Risborough, Buckinghamshire, Ercol’s expert craftsmen handmake each piece of furniture from solid oak, elm, beech and ash. The brand was founded in 1920 by Lucian Ercolani, with a vision to design and create the finest living room and dining room furniture using natural materials. This much loved brand has been featured at the Festival of Britain in 1951, the Queens Silver Jubilee Exhibition in 1977 and the V&A Museum during the London Design Festival in 2009. To this day, Ercol is known for its combination of quality craftsmanship, elegant design and functionality. Their classic bar stools, dining chairs, coffee tables and more furniture from their mid-century living room and dining room collections are still popular with customers today, and they continue to deliver to these high standards in their newer collections.

VISPRING

/live/blogs/vispring 2.jpg

Back in 1899, James Marshall invented the revolutionary pocket spring mattress to provide the utmost comfort for his wife who was taken ill. Vispring was founded 2 years later, 1 year before the first Lee Longlands showroom opened its doors. These bedmakers still build all their divans and mattresses by hand, using only the finest fillings and Vanadium steel springs. Associated with premium and luxury, Vispring has had partnerships with legendary English vessels from the Mauretania to the Queen Elizabeth II, and most recently with the Plymouth-based yacht builder, Princess Yacht. In 2012, Vispring was awarded the Queen’s Award for Enterprise.

PARKER KNOLL

/live/blogs/parker knoll 2.jpg

Parker Knoll was founded in 1931, but the story of Frederick Parker and Sons dates back to 1869. Originally handcrafting the finest chairs for Victorian gentry, Parker Knoll went on to furnish most of the rooms and studios at the BBC headquarters in 1932, provide the chair in which King Edward VIII abdicated the throne and was involved with manufacturing aircraft during WWII. In 1996, the brand was named the Number 1 Furniture Brand in the UK. Parker Knoll today is still a much loved brand in England, handcrafting their iconic sofas and chairs from the finest materials to offer style, class and comfort in the homes of their customers. In both leather and fabric, Parker Knoll produce a range of classic sofas, armchairs, wing chairs and recliners.

HYPNOS

/live/blogs/hypnos 1.jpg

A favourite amongst the royals, Hypnos has held a Royal Warrant since 1929, meaning for 89 years, they have supplied the Royal Family and Royal Household with mattresses, divans and bespoke upholstery. Founded in 1904, the brand continues to be a family-run business today with chairman, Peter Keen, being the fourth generation to run the business. Hypnos has been awarded the Queen’s Award for Enterprise for International Trade, the Royal Seal of Approval, the Manufacturing Guild Mark and Bed Manufacturer of the Year 3 times. These handcrafted deep pocket spring divans and mattresses combine traditional craftsmanship with constant innovation, and use only the finest natural materials.
